Search Result for "stafette": 

The Collaborative International Dictionary of English v.0.48:

Stafette \Sta*fette"\ (st[.a]*f[e^]t"), n. [Cf. G. stafette. See Estafet.] An estafet. [R.] --Carlyle. [1913 Webster]